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Syndax reported net revenue of $20 million for RevuForge in Q1 2025, marking the first full quarter of its launch [8][35] - Nictimvo generated $13.6 million in net revenue for the first two months of its launch, with Syndax reporting a collaboration loss of only $200,000 for this period [8][36] - The company maintained a strong financial position with $602.1 million in cash and equivalents as of March 31, 2025 [9][38]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- RevuForge's launch has seen strong adoption, with 44% of tier one and tier two accounts ordering the product as of March, up from one-third in February [16][17] - Nictimvo has been administered in over 1,250 infusions year-to-date, with approximately 95% of top accounts ordering the product [25][26]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The current indication for RevuForge targets an estimated 2,000 patients in the U.S. with relapsed or refractory acute leukemia, representing a market opportunity of $750 million [22] - The total addressable market for Nictimvo is estimated to be between $1.5 billion to $2 billion, targeting 6,500 chronic GVHD patients in the U.S. [27][10] Company Strategy and Development Direction - Syndax aims to position RevuForge as the first menin inhibitor included in clinical guidelines for treating relapsed or refractory mutant NPM1 AML [13] - The company is focused on executing strategic launch imperatives to ensure long-term competitive immunity ahead of potential market entrants [23] - The EVOLVE-two trial is a pivotal frontline study for Rebuminav, aiming for accelerated approval and full approval based on dual primary endpoints [29][30]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the strong commercial opportunities for both RevuForge and Nictimvo, highlighting the unmet medical needs and the compelling profiles of their medicines [8][10] - The company anticipates that RevuForge will be the first menin inhibitor approved in the frontline setting, with ongoing engagement with the FDA on their submissions [11][14] Other Important Information - The company has submitted a supplemental new drug application (sNDA) for RevuForge, seeking priority review for treating relapsed or refractory mutant NPM1 AML [10] - The FDA's real-time oncology review program is expected to facilitate quicker approvals for their submissions [11] Q&A Session Summary Question: What are you seeing regarding repeat prescribers for RevuForge? - Management noted that 44% of tier one and tier two accounts have ordered, with about 80% of those ordering more than once, indicating a growing user base [43][46] Question: Are you seeing a similar pace of patients receiving transplants with RevuForge as in clinical trials? - Management stated that anecdotal information suggests patients are being taken to transplant, but it is too early to provide definitive data [52][53] Question: Can you share any color on month-over-month trends for new patient adds for RevuForge in Q1? - Management indicated that while they are not providing specific numbers yet, they are happy with the steady stream of new patients and refill rates [58][60] Question: What portion of the $20 million revenue stems from refill dynamics versus new patient starts? - Management mentioned that both refill and new patient dynamics are building, but specific data is still maturing [101][102]
